Stepping into the realm of commercial real estate can be both exciting, but it's crucial to approach lease agreements with care. These contracts outline the parameters governing your tenancy of a property, and failing to understand them fully can lead to operational pitfalls down the line. This legal guide aims to shed light on key aspects of commercial lease agreements, empowering businesses to make informed decisions that protect their interests.

First and foremost, it's essential to meticulously review the term of the lease. This establishes how long you are obligated to occupy the premises. Consider your business needs and project future growth when evaluating the lease term. Furthermore, pay close scrutiny to the rent arrangement. This should be clearly defined, including the base rent amount, any escalation clauses, and the payment schedule.

Estate Planning: Protecting Your heir's Future Through Wills and Trusts

Estate planning can seem like a daunting task, but it's crucial for securing your family's financial well-being after you're gone. A comprehensive estate plan typically includes testaments that outline how your assets should be distributed and trusts that can help protect your wealth from claims. By carefully crafting these legal instruments, you can ensure your family is cared for even in your absence.

It's important to consult with an experienced estate planning attorney who can counsel you on the best strategies for your unique circumstances. They can help you navigate the complexities of estate law and establish a plan that meets your goals.

Remember, effective estate planning is about more than just assets; it's about assurance knowing that your family will be protected in the future.

Creating Your Non-Profit's Structure

Establishing a non-profit organization is a rewarding endeavor, but it necessitates careful planning and consideration. One of the most crucial aspects is structuring your non-profit legally to ensure smooth operations and alignment with regulations. A well-defined structure provides a framework for governance, functioning, and financial clarity.

  • Choosing the right legal structure, such as an incorporation or unincorporated association, is paramount. Each structure has distinct implications for liability, taxation, and operational versatility.
  • Developing a comprehensive set of bylaws that outline the organization's mission, goals, and internal procedures is essential.
  • Putting in Place robust financial management systems and adhering to ethical practices are crucial for maintaining public confidence.

Consulting with legal and financial professionals can provide invaluable guidance throughout the process, helping you navigate the complexities of non-profit law and set your organization up for long-term success.

Grasping Corporate Governance in the Modern Business World

In today's dynamic business landscape, effective corporate governance has become paramount. It involves a set of guidelines and frameworks that regulate the operations of an organization, promoting transparency, accountability, and responsible conduct. Furthermore, strong corporate governance structures are essential for building trust with shareholders and mitigating risks, ultimately contributing to long-term sustainability.
